Hey guys i have a toadstool in my tank, thats base ( the very bottom of it) has streched between two rocks, about a inch on the second rock. Wat would happen if i cut it from the second rock as close as i can to the first rock with the main coral on it. Might it grow a second leather over time? If it wont hurt it i will be cutting it anyways as its becoming a problem with the leathers location.

Alright well i just sliced through it as close as possible with a razor blade, and moved the small piece were i can see it better to keep a eye on it. the spot were it was cut is about as big around as a #2 pencil, about a inch long with a bigger part at bottom. The Area i cut is white flesh look with tiny little pin prick holes in it. Dont really care if it grows a second one but it sure would be okay with me lol.
